What are Remote ATAK jobs?

Remote ATAK jobs involve working with the Android Team Awareness Kit (ATAK) software from a remote location. ATAK is a geospatial and situational awareness tool used primarily by military, law enforcement, and emergency responders to coordinate operations and share real-time data. Professionals in remote ATAK roles may be responsible for software development, technical support, training, or system integration, all performed virtually. These jobs typically require knowledge of geospatial technologies, secure communications, and experience with ATAK or similar platforms. Remote ATAK roles offer flexibility while supporting mission-critical operations and clients worldwide.

SAIC is seeking a highly skilled Principal Field Engineer to serve as a Technical Subject Matter Expert (SME) on the Joint Range Extension (JRE) Team. In this critical role, you will support customer engagements, enable tactical mission success, and provide expert guidance across the full spectrum of Tactical Data Link (TDL) operations. The ideal candidate brings deep operational understanding of tactical data links, existing tactical data link capability gaps, and demonstrates the ability to drive innovation to mitigate those gaps, all while working independently in a hybrid environment. The ideal candidate brings deep operational understanding in Army Aviation, Link-16, ATAK/WINTAK, and VMF, along with the ability to work independently in a hybrid environment.
This position requires a dynamic, self-motivated professional with strong problem-solving skills, excellent communication abilities, and the capacity to manage travel, schedules, and coordination across a distributed team.
This REMOTE role requires residency in the Huntsville, Alabama area. Travel up to 25% may be required, typically in short durations of one to two weeks.
JOB DUTIES:
  • Partner with JRE team members to ensure timely, high-quality support to end users while contributing to future capability planning and development.
  • Act as a primary point of contact for customers and stakeholders, delivering expert support across Tactical Data Link operations.
  • Collaborate with end users to define and document JRE capability requirements.
  • Identify, define, and communicate new software capability needs to both technical and programming teams.
  • Support test and evaluation events, providing technical insight and operational expertise.

Qualifications
REQUIREMENTS:
  • Bachelors and nine (9) years or more experience; Masters and seven (7) years or more experience ; PhD or JD and four (4) years or more experience. Equivalent operational experience in TDL may be considered.
  • Must be a U.S. Citizen.
  • Must have an Active Secret Clearance to start.
  • Must have background in Army Aviation, Link-16, ATAK/WINTAK, VMF operational experience.
  • Demonstrated experience in:
    • Tactical Data Link (TDL) Operations
    • Army Integrated Air and Missile Defense (AIAMD) Operations
    • Army Capability Management
    • Integrated Battle Command System (IBCS)
    • Link-16 operations
    • Joint Range Extension Application Protocol (JREAP)
    • ATAK and WINTAK programs (TAK)
    • Variable Message Format (VMF)
    • MIL-STDs and STANAGs

DESIRED SKILLS:
  • Joint Interface Control Officer (JICO) Certification.
  • Program Management.
  • Patriot Missile System.
